It offers 2 restaurants, 3 bars and free parking.
The Royal Wells owes its name to Queen Victoria who frequently stayed at the hotel as a young princess in the early 19th-century.
Each room is individually designed and furnished with antiques.
Features include tea and coffee making facilities and en suite bathrooms.
Guests can also use Wi-Fi free of charge in the entire building.
The Conservatory Restaurant, with its intimate lounge bar, uses fresh, local produce.
Guests may also want to try out the newly refurbished Chalybeate Restaurant.
Together with The Ephraim Bar, The Beau Nash pub and The Wells Bar also offer an extensive list of drinks and dishes.
The Royal Wells has weekly live music on Saturday nights.
